Transaction ecc47a759df31c522d7009b230f4eec221b60fdc1432417365dc96e59e9ad37f
2 Input
2 Outputs
- ecc47a759df31c522d7009b230f4eec221b60fdc1432417365dc96e59e9ad37f:0
- ecc47a759df31c522d7009b230f4eec221b60fdc1432417365dc96e59e9ad37f:1
value 28486153
address 161xu2ciQzPakWwuEHwfC1n9VVHPzSsqQ9
value 34769238
address 374NGwMoAeYTfNCCpjnaYovuesgs5iu8Fi